Princeton: Redefining Brushes and Tools for Artists

Princeton Artist Brush Company are a leader in crafting high quality brushes and painting tools for artists. Their wide range has been designed for all mediums, including oil, acrylic, watercolour paint, gouache, and more.

Founded by Howard Kaufman in Princeton, New Jersey, the company began with a mission to make innovative, affordable, and reliable tools for artists. Princeton’s dedication to meeting the needs of artists is evident in their exceptional ranges, including Princeton Velvetouch, Aqua Elite, Neptune Brushes, and the revolutionary Princeton Catalyst Wedges and Blades.

Collaborating with Naohide Takamoto, a master brushmaker from Japan’s renowned Takamoto family, Princeton developed their flagship Series 4050 synthetic sable brushes. This range set a new standard for synthetic brush performance. Princeton have continued to innovate, introducing cutting-edge technologies like Neptune™, Velvetouch™, and Catalyst™ Polytip Brushes, which offer excellent control and precision for a wide range of media.

Princeton’s Catalyst Wedges and Blades, crafted from heat-resistant silicone, are ideal for heavy-bodied paints, as well as encaustics and clay. This makes them a favourite for both traditional and experimental artists. These versatile tools are designed to push the boundaries of creativity, offering durability and performance unmatched by traditional brushes.

Now based in Appleton, Wisconsin, Princeton Artist Brush Company remains committed to providing artists with the best tools to express their creativity. From their versatile brushes to innovative tools like the Catalyst Wedge, Princeton continues to inspire and support the art community with their passion for quality and innovation.


‘One of the things that enticed me to this range in particular was the non-glare ferrule. It is like Princeton knew I wanted this brush for painting a large artwork outside! The stiffness of the brush also makes it perfect for big sweeping motions, but equally small delicate markings.

The brush also holds water and bounces back into shape very well, which I find very helpful when you’re in the midst of your creative flow and you don’t have to worry about water or the disconfigured shape of the brush.’

- Artist Emily Harman Tests Princeton Aspen Bristle Brushes, ‘Princeton Brushes for Oil, Acrylic, and Watercolour’, Jackson’s Art Blog.
